Lai Sun Development Co  (STU:LAY3) Quick Ratio Explanation

The quick ratio is more conservative than the Current Ratio because it excludes inventories from current assets. The ratio derives its name presumably from the fact that assets such as cash and marketable securities are quick sources of cash. Inventories generally take time to be converted into cash, and if they have to be sold quickly, the company may have to accept a lower price than book value of these inventories. As a result, they are justifiably excluded from assets that are ready sources of immediate cash.

In general, low or decreasing quick ratios generally suggest that a company is over-leveraged, struggling to maintain or grow sales, paying bills too quickly or collecting receivables too slowly. On the other hand, a high or increasing quick ratio generally indicates that a company is experiencing solid top-line growth, quickly converting receivables into cash, and easily able to cover its financial obligations. Such companies often have faster inventory turnover and cash conversion cycles.

The higher the quick ratio, the better the company's liquidity position.

Lai Sun Development Co Quick Ratio Calculation

The quick ratio measures a company's ability to meet its short-term obligations with its most liquid assets. For this reason, the ratio excludes inventories from current assets.

Lai Sun Development Co's Quick Ratio for the fiscal year that ended in Jul. 2025 is calculated as

Quick Ratio (A: Jul. 2025 )=(Total Current Assets-Total Inventories)/Total Current Liabilities
=(1517.093-868.398)/2009.072
=0.32

Lai Sun Development Co's Quick Ratio for the quarter that ended in Jan. 2026 is calculated as

Quick Ratio (Q: Jan. 2026 )=(Total Current Assets-Total Inventories)/Total Current Liabilities
=(1809.846-816.756)/1723.67
=0.58

Lai Sun Development Co Business Description

Other Exchanges 00488:Hong KongLAY3:Germany
Address 680 Cheung Sha Wan Road, 11th Floor, Lai Sun Commercial Centre, Kowloon, Hong Kong, HKG
Lai Sun Development Co Ltd is an investment holding company. Along with its subsidiaries, the company is engaged in various reportable operating segments such as; property development and sales; property investment; hotel operation; restaurant operation; media and entertainment; film and TV programs; cinema operation; theme park operation, and others. The property development and sales segment which derives a majority of its revenue, is engaged in property development and the sale of properties. Geographically, it derives a majority of its revenue from Mainland China and Macau, and the rest from Hong Kong, the United Kingdom, Vietnam, and other regions.
